Back to the subject, most small resorts near communities in the US have smaller numbers of "regulars" who are usually required to join a club for membership. Some clubs allow "day members" if they are aanr members and some other local stipulations are met. Piercings for genitals and nipples are usually not allowed. It is NOT a sexual environment. However, large, well known public nude beaches (Haulover Beach in Miami comes to mind, has a very diverse crowd, and perhaps because it is Miami, a lot of the folks there are "hot" by any ones standard. Lots of tourists from out of town who are curious and such, but a lot of locals who are hot and don't like tan lines. Some other places are scattered around the country like that. Interestingly, a resort club with a very similar clientele is Caliente just north of Tampa. This is very upscale and they are selective on who gets on the grounds. Again, many "pretty" people. Being a member helps. And this is a resort where people buy homes to live there and condo's, etc. This is not a "camp" by any stretch of the imagination.
